Lou*_*e79 1 users password accounts ibm-hmc
hscroot@hmcserver:~> grep root /etc/group
root:x:0:hscroot,ccfw
hscroot@hmcserver:~>
hscroot@hmcserver:~> ls -la /etc/shadow
-r-------- 1 root shadow 5252 2015-05-06 19:36 /etc/shadow
hscroot@hmcserver:~>
hscroot@hmcserver:~> cat /etc/shadow
cat: /etc/shadow: Permission denied
hscroot@hmcserver:~>
hscroot@hmcserver:~> grep hscroot /etc/passwd
hscroot:x:500:500:HMC Super User:/home/hscroot:/bin/hmcbash
hscroot@hmcserver:~>
hscroot@hmcserver:~> echo $DISPLAY
localhost:10.0
hscroot@hmcserver:~>
hscroot@hmcserver:~> su -
bash: su: command not found
hscroot@hmcserver:~> sudo su -
bash: sudo: command not found
hscroot@hmcserver:~> bash
bash: bash: command not found
hscroot@hmcserver:~> chs
bash: chs: command not found
hscroot@hmcserver:~> ksh
bash: ksh: command not found
hscroot@hmcserver:~> ls /bin/bash
/bin/bash
hscroot@hmcserver:~> /bin/bash
bash: /bin/bash: restricted: cannot specify `/' in command names
hscroot@hmcserver:~> exit
exit
Connection to 1.2.3.4 closed.
[user@notebook ~]$ ssh hscroot@1.2.3.4 /bin/bash
Password:
/bin/bash: /bin/bash: restricted: cannot specify `/' in command names
[user@notebook ~]$
Run Code Online (Sandbox Code Playgroud)
问题:我怎样才能找到“ /etc/shadow ”?我只有“hscroot”用户。
如果我使用“ssh -X”,我有 X 转发。
您向 IBM 提交了一个支持电话,然后 IBM 会为您提供hscpe用户密码,该密码可以使用一天。该用户 ID 和密码允许您访问 root(假设您在安装 HMC 时记录了 root 密码)。那么你可以cat /etc/shadow
。
您不能在没有 root 访问权限的情况下(按设计)执行此操作,也不能在 HMC 上(也按设计)简单地切换到 root。